2017-02-20 44 views
0

我正在使用Polymer js,假設我有頁面A,B,C,並且我在頁面A中請求登錄API調用,並且我需要頁面B和C中的響應,直到用戶註銷。所以當我得到響應時,我將響應存儲在一個JS局部變量中,然後將該變量綁定到頁面B和C上,並使用數據綁定和傳遞值,直到刷新頁面B或C時才起作用。當我刷新頁面B或C所有我的本地變量被銷燬,頁面B和C取決於頁面A的數據,甚至我不能將整個響應存儲在localstorage中,因爲任何人都可以編輯。這種類型的問題的解決方案是什麼,即當我們沒有頁面時特定API?API響應數據如何保持結束?如果我沒有頁面特定的API調用,該怎麼辦?

回答

0

如果你沒有找到你正在尋找的本地變量,那麼你可以再次使用signIn Api,然後一旦你得到響應,將它再次存儲在內存中。

對於signIn API的工作,你可以存儲傳遞的數據在第一個地方。並在隨後的通話中再次通過。

+0

但每次登錄時我都會得到一個唯一的會話ID,我無法調用該API的mant時間 – hande

相關問題